Hydrometer Reading For Salt Water. Hydrometers are used to measure the oceans salinity, or how “salty” the ocean is. The higher the salinity, the higher the tube floats and the larger the number that lines up with the water’s surface. Hydrometers are calibrated to be most accurate when the water is 77°f (25°c). A hydrometer is a device that measures the density or specific gravity of a liquid. As a general guideline for saltwater reef tanks, it is best to maintain a salinity of 1.026 (or 35ppt or 53 ms/cm conductivity) to most. The more salt in the water the more dense it is.
